servo/ports/cef/values.rs
author Mike Blumenkrantz <zmike@osg.samsung.com>
Thu, 07 May 2015 14:10:29 -0500
changeset 382973 496bf169306f2cbc5f23cc529a5f6be30851e0b3
parent 382278 683502b1b8e9954f61459faa23dada130de02ead
permissions -rw-r--r--
servo: Merge #5955 - Embedding rebase rage (from zmike:embedding-REBASE_RAGE); r=larsbergstrom This updates all the CEF interface stuff to the current CEF codebase. Source-Repo: https://github.com/servo/servo Source-Revision: 92f46e3149df7de59aa5aa6700c1878958e2f273

/* This Source Code Form is subject to the terms of the Mozilla Public
 * License, v. 2.0. If a copy of the MPL was not distributed with this
 * file, You can obtain one at http://mozilla.org/MPL/2.0/. */

use interfaces::{cef_binary_value_t, cef_dictionary_value_t, cef_list_value_t, cef_value_t};

use libc;

cef_stub_static_method_impls! {
    fn cef_binary_value_create(_data: *const (), _size: libc::size_t) -> *mut cef_binary_value_t
    fn cef_dictionary_value_create() -> *mut cef_dictionary_value_t
    fn cef_list_value_create() -> *mut cef_list_value_t
    fn cef_value_create() -> *mut cef_value_t
}